Frequently asked questions on the trip Gelsenkirchen - Regensburg
How much does a cheap train ticket from Gelsenkirchen to Regensburg cost?
The average train ticket price from Gelsenkirchen to Regensburg is US$55. The best way to find cheap train tickets from Gelsenkirchen to Regensburg is to book your tickets as early as possible. Prices tend to rise as your travel date approaches, so book in advance to secure the best prices!
How long is the train trip from Gelsenkirchen to Regensburg?
A train trip between Gelsenkirchen and Regensburg is around 12h 12m, although the fastest train will take about 9h 15m. This is the time it takes to travel the 280 miles that separates the two cities.
How many daily train are there between Gelsenkirchen and Regensburg?
The number of trains from Gelsenkirchen to Regensburg can differ depending on the day of the week. On average, there are 2. Some trains are direct while others include transferring trains. Did you know?
You can find dogs as passengers on the trains of Moscow, where there is a large number of stray dogs. Over time, the dogs have learned the inner workings of the rail system and it is not uncommon to find one travelling between the city and the suburbs.
Railway companies played a major role as early as 1883 in the use of time zones as we know them today.
New York holds the record for the most platforms and track numbers in a single station. Grand Central Station in Manhattan is one of the largest rail terminals in the world with more than 44 platforms and 67 tracks to accommodate passengers.
